bad spark? 200 1977

Greetings all-

I am still having trouble with the rough idle on my 1977 244 w/B21F engine. I tuned it up a couple of weeks ago, but it still is rough. I just replaced all of the spark plug wires (Bosch) and coil wire, spark plugs, rotor, and distributor cap. I also timed it. But still rough. The compression for each cylinder is fine. When it is running, and I pull out the wire for #3 or 4 spark plug, the engine doesn't change. But if I pull #1 or 2 out, the engine dies. I pulled each plug out one at a time to see if a spark was getting to it, and it was. Now, the car has very little power and struggles to idle.

Any advice would be greatly appreciated (newbie), because I an running out of ideas and I think my wife is thinking that I shouldn't have bought the car . . .
